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/image-processing/2.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181

Warning: file_get_contents(/data/phpspider/zhask/data//catemap/1/angularjs/23.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
如何将数据从DataGridView保存到数据库中?c#winforms_C# - Fatal编程技术网

如何将数据从DataGridView保存到数据库中?c#winforms

如何将数据从DataGridView保存到数据库中?c#winforms,c#,C#,我有一个小应用程序,它的作用是用户可以向某个员工添加许多扣减并保存记录 我在编码中所做的是将所有值传递给DataTable,循环遍历每一行,并执行一个存储过程,用列值插入特定行。直到数据表中没有要插入的行时,才会发生这种情况 有捷径吗?我的意思是,我能在一次调用中插入datatable的整个值吗? 我只是认为我当前插入数据的方式非常消耗资源,因为只要datatable中有行,它就总是调用服务器中的存储过程 有什么解决办法或建议吗?我会非常感激的。我希望你能理解我,。提前感谢。请查看这些链接

我有一个小应用程序,它的作用是用户可以向某个员工添加许多扣减并保存记录

我在编码中所做的是将所有值传递给
DataTable
,循环遍历每一行,并执行一个存储过程,用列值插入特定行。直到数据表中没有要插入的行时,才会发生这种情况

有捷径吗?我的意思是,我能在一次调用中插入datatable的整个值吗? 我只是认为我当前插入数据的方式非常消耗资源,因为只要datatable中有行,它就总是调用服务器中的存储过程


有什么解决办法或建议吗?我会非常感激的。我希望你能理解我,。提前感谢。

请查看这些链接